Ignore:
Timestamp:
8 Nov 2015, 06:18:44 (9 years ago)
Author:
Henrik Bettermann
Message:

Remove duplicate payment category.

Location:
main/waeup.aaue/trunk/src/waeup/aaue/interswitch
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• main/waeup.aaue/trunk/src/waeup/aaue/interswitch/browser.py

    r13409 r13410  
    271271                xmldict['institution_bank_id'] = '117'
    272272
    273             if self.context.p_category == 'clearance_incl':
     273            if self.context.p_category.endswith('_incl'):
    274274                # Clearance including additional fees
    275275                gown_fee_amt = academic_session.matric_gown_fee - \
     
    373373</payment_item_detail>""" % xmldict
    374374
    375         # Medical Acceptance
    376         elif self.context.p_category == 'medical':
    377             self.pay_item_id = '108'
    378             xmldict['institution_acct'] = '1010827641'
    379             xmldict['institution_bank_id'] = '117'
    380             xmldict['institution_amt'] = 100 * (
    381                 self.context.amount_auth -
    382                 dynamic_gateway_amt(self.context.amount_auth))
    383             xmltext = """<payment_item_detail>
    384 <item_details detail_ref="%(detail_ref)s" college="%(institution_name)s" department="%(department)s" faculty="%(faculty)s">
    385 <item_detail item_id="1" item_name="%(institution_item_name)s" item_amt="%(institution_amt)d" bank_id="%(institution_bank_id)s" acct_num="%(institution_acct)s" />
    386 </item_details>
    387 </payment_item_detail>""" % xmldict
    388 
    389375        # Hostel Maintenance
    390376        elif self.context.p_category == 'hostel_maintenance':
  • main/waeup.aaue/trunk/src/waeup/aaue/interswitch/tests.py

    r13408 r13410  
    140140            in self.browser.contents)
    141141        self.assertTrue(
    142             'item_name="School Fee plus" '
     142            'item_name="School Fee Plus" '
    143143            'item_amt="4600000" bank_id="7" '
    144144            'acct_num="1014847058"' in self.browser.contents)
     
    215215            in self.browser.contents)
    216216        self.assertTrue(
    217             'item_name="Acceptance Fee plus" '
     217            'item_name="Acceptance Fee Plus" '
    218218            'item_amt="4000000" bank_id="117" '
    219219            'acct_num="1014066976"' in self.browser.contents)
Note: See TracChangeset for help on using the changeset viewer.